Located at the heart of New Cross, the station offers a wide range of amenities designed to make your travel experience as seamless as possible. The ticket office is operational from early morning to late evening—Monday to Friday from 06:45 until 19:15, Saturday from 06:10 to 20:00, and Sunday from 08:30 to 20:00. For added convenience, there are ticket machines where you can also collect tickets purchased online, including accessible machines located at the station forecourt and booking hall.
Smartcards are an excellent way to streamline your travels, and New Cross issues and validates these cards for your ease. The station provides a secure environment with CCTV surveillance and help points that ensure assistance is always at hand from early morning till midnight. However, if you're traveling with luggage, be mindful that there are no storage facilities, so plan accordingly.
The station has made significant strides in ensuring that it caters to passengers with additional accessibility needs. While parts of the station offer step-free access, more detailed checks are recommended as platforms A and B can be accessed via lifts, and there are short but steep ramps from some entrances. There are also accessible toilets and a ramp available for train access, making your travel as comfortable as possible.
For those with bicycles, New Cross offers 22 storage spaces on Platform C, although they are unsheltered and use is at your own risk. If you're thinking of cycling through London, remember that there are no cycle hire facilities at this station. On the tech side, public Wi-Fi might not be available, but pay phones ensure you're never out of touch.

Set in the charming village of Streethouse, West Yorkshire, the Streethouse train station offers passengers a gateway to a variety of destinations. It's part of the Wakefield to Knottingley Line, connecting travelers to vibrant cities and quaint towns across the region. While it may not boast the bustling amenities of larger stations, Streethouse provides a simple and effective railway service that delivers you promptly to your destination.
Streethouse station operates without a ticket office, yet it efficiently provides ticket machines for all your travel needs. You can easily collect tickets purchased online at these machines. Although induction loops are provided for accessibility, the ticket machines themselves are not fully accessible, which is crucial information for those with mobility concerns. The station remains unstaffed, yet rest assured that help is just a phone call away via their helpline at 0800 200 6060.
If you require step-free access, it's worth noting that while some areas of the station accommodate this, access for wheelchair users may be challenging due to high kerbs. Therefore, passengers are encouraged to explore the 360 map linked here if you wish to see the station layout. Car parking at the station is available 24/7 and comes at no cost, although spaces are limited.
